6/30 La Jolla AM...cuda infestation

....and pesky makos

greenbacks were tough, but got 6 and headed to the point. Calicos were liking the mackeral, so I took my last 2 out to deeper water. Tons of spanish and sardines, scattered and balled up. Had a clicker screamer, threw it in gear and looking back a decent sized mako went airborn and pop! I heard another stayed on for multiple jumps before parting. barracuda went insane around 8:30. Alot of legals in the mix today. I had one fish that ran twice like a YT before popping off, so they may be mixed in. Had to leave em boiling as duty called.......stupid ice Saw alot of batrays crossing the canyon and the surf is full of shovelnose and leapards, full on Summer mode. Another really nice (bloodless) morning.
